Life out of duora and out of the g4mes which they play arid the enjoy­
ment which tliry receive and the efforts which they make, comes the
greater part of that healthful development which ia so essential to their
happiness when gr. wn. When a lavative ia needed the remedy whi. 11 ia
given t > them to cleanse and sweeten and strengthen the internal organs
on »huh it aits, should tie such aa physicians would san, lion, be. ause its
component part» are known to tie wh.4es.iin« and the remedy itself free fr .in
every objectionable quality. The one remedy which physicians and parents,
well informed, approve and recommend and which the little ones enjoy,
because of ita pleasant flavor, ita gentle action and ita beneficial effects, ia
Hyrupof Figs and for the same reason it ia the only lasativc which should
be used by fathers and mothers.
Syrup of Figs ia the only remedy which acta gently, pleasantly and
naturally without griping, irritating, or nauseating and which cleanses the
system effectually, without producing that constipated habit whit h results
from the use of the old-time cathartics and modern imitations, and against
who h the children should tie so carefully guarded. If you would have them
grow to manhood and womanh.axl, strong, healthy and happy, do not give
them medicines, when medicines are not needed, and when nature nml,
assistant e in the way of a laiative. give them only the aimpl«, pleasant and
gentle Hyrupof Figs.
